Potential Issues to Watch Out For
When inspecting a 1 bedroom condo, there are several potential issues you should be on the lookout for. These can range from minor cosmetic problems to more serious structural issues.
- Water Damage or Leaks
Water damage or leaks can be a significant issue in a condo, especially if they’re not addressed promptly. Look for signs of water stains on the ceiling or walls, musty odors, or water spots on the floors. Check the condition of the gutters and downspouts, as well as the roof for any signs of damage or wear.Water damage or leaks can also be hidden behind walls or under flooring, so it’s a good idea to hire a professional inspector who can use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ture.
According to the American Society of Home Inspectors, water damage is a leading cause of home inspections, with approximately 25% of inspections revealing some level of water damage.
- Check the condition of the condo’s exterior walls for any signs of water damage or stains, which could indicate a problem with the underlying structure.
- Inspect the condo’s roof for any missing, damaged, or loose shingles or tiles.
- Check the gutters and downspouts to ensure they’re securely attached and functioning properly.
- Look for any signs of water spots or stains on the floors or walls, which could indicate a leak from the roof or other source.
- Termite or Pest Infestation
Termite or pest infestation can cause significant damage to a condo’s structure, including the foundation, walls, and floors. If you notice any signs of termite or pest activity, such as discarded wings, mud tunnels, or small holes in the walls or floors, it’s essential to notify the seller and/or a pest control professional right away.To inspect for termite or pest activity, look for any signs of damage to the condo’s woodwork, including the foundation, walls, and floors. Check for any small holes or gaps in the walls or floors, which could indicate termite or pest activity.
According to the National Pest Management Association, pest infestations can cause significant damage to a home’s structure, with termite damage alone estimated at over $5 billion annually.
- Check the condo’s foundation, walls, and floors for any signs of damage or wear.
- Look for any small holes or gaps in the walls or floors, which could indicate termite or pest activity.
- Check for any signs of termite or pest activity, such as discarded wings or mud tunnels.
- Electrical Issues
Electrical issues can pose a significant safety risk to occupants, and in some cases, even cause fires. When inspecting the condo, check for any signs of electrical issues, such as flickering lights, warm outlets, or frayed cords.To inspect the condo’s electrical system, check for any signs of damage or wear to the wiring, outlets, and switches. Look for any signs of rodent or pest activity in the electrical panel or wiring.
According to the National Electrical Manufacturers Association, electrical fires are a leading cause of home fires, accounting for over 50,000 reported fires annually.
- Check for any signs of damage or wear to the wiring, outlets, and switches.
- Look for any signs of rodent or pest activity in the electrical panel or wiring.
- Check for any signs of flickering lights or warm outlets.
The Importance of Hiring a Professional Inspector
While it’s possible to conduct a DIY inspection of a 1 bedroom condo, it’s often recommended to hire a professional inspector to identify potential issues. A professional inspector has the training, experience, and equipment to detect hidden problems that may not be visible to the naked eye.
When hiring a professional inspector, look for someone who is certified by a reputable organization, such as the American Society of Home Inspectors (ASHI). Check their credentials, read online reviews, and ask for references before hiring them for the inspection.

Understanding the Local Market and Recent Sales Data
The local market conditions significantly impact the price of a condo for sale. If you’re buying in an area with high demand and limited supply, you can expect the prices to be higher. Therefore, it’s essential to understand the local market conditions before making an offer.
Here are some ways to stay informed about the local market:
– Analyze recent sales data: Look at the sales prices of similar condos in the area, considering factors such as location, size, and amenities.
– Check the local real estate trend: Websites like Zillow, Redfin, or Realtor.com provide valuable information on the local market trends.
– Consult with a real estate agent: A local real estate agent can provide valuable insights into the local market and help you make a more informed decision.
Strategies for Negotiating the Price of a 1 Bedroom Condo for Sale
When negotiating the price of a condo, there are several strategies you can use to get the best deal. Here are some effective negotiation strategies:
- Do your research: As mentioned earlier, it’s essential to understand the local market and recent sales data. This information will help you make a more informed decision and negotiate a better price.
- Make a reasonable offer: Don’t make an offer that’s too low, as this can offend the seller and damage the negotiation process. Instead, make a reasonable offer based on your research and the local market trends.
- Be prepared to walk away: If your offer is rejected, be prepared to walk away from the deal. This shows the seller that you’re not desperate and can help you negotiations.
- Use the inspection period wisely: If you’re making an offer on a condo, include an inspection period in your contract. This allows you to inspect the property and identify any potential issues.
